0 <br />STATE OF COLORADO <br />MINED LAND RECLAMATION BOARD <br />DEPARTMENT OF NATURAL RESOURCES <br />IN THE MATTER OF: High Flains Stone Company ) BOARD ORDER <br />P.O. E~ox 100 ) <br />Castle Rock, CO 80104 ) <br />T0: High Plains Stone Co., Scott Wagner and all other persons engaged in or <br />owning or controlling the following operation: South 40 Quarry, NE NW Section <br />14, Township 175, Range 68W, 6th P.M. Fremont County <br />FINDINGS OF FACT <br />Pursuant to the authority vested in the State of Colorado Mined Land <br />Reclamation Board by C.R.S. 34-32-124, the Board hereby makes the following <br />findings of fact: <br />1. On August 26, 1992 the Board issued Notice of Violation and Cease and <br />Desist Order M-92-057 to High Plains Stone Company. <br />2. On November 19, 1992 the Board conducted a hearing in accordance with <br />C.R.S. 24-4-101 et sec. to consider the matter of corrective actions <br />for NOV M-92-057 by High Plains Stone Company. <br />2.
